針式PKM幫助四 基於資料庫的超快搜尋

2022-01-13 20:17:46 字數 688 閱讀 5463

1.通過標題搜尋。通過標題搜尋所要的時間接近於0秒!比windows資源管理器至少快10000倍

a)在搜尋型別的下拉框中選擇「標題」。如圖(十)

b)輸入關鍵字

c)按回車或單擊「搜尋」按鈕

*沒有找到,知識點列表會顯示「空」

*標題包括知識點的標題和知識點關聯檔案的標題

*搜尋範圍:全部表示「所有的分類」,另乙個表示在當前的分類範圍內

2.通過全文搜尋。通過全文要用較長時間,但比windows資源管理器至少快100倍;因為windows資源管理器是基於文字,而針式pkm是基於資料庫的

a)在搜尋型別的下拉框中選擇「全文」。

b)輸入關鍵字

c)按回車或單擊「搜尋」按鈕

*沒有找到,知識點列表會顯示「空」

*全文指知識點的「預設word文件」的內容

*搜尋範圍:只能使用「全部」,表示「所有的分類」,另乙個表示在當前的分類範圍內將不可用

3.通過「全部」搜尋

全部包括標題、分類、標籤和全文

a)在搜尋型別的下拉框中選擇「全部」。

b)輸入關鍵字

c)按回車或單擊「搜尋」按鈕

*沒有找到,知識點列表會顯示「空」

*全文指知識點的「預設word文件」的內容

*搜尋範圍:全部表示「所有的分類」;另乙個表示在當前的分類範圍內,包括標題、分類等,但不包括全文內容

基於資料庫的分布式鎖

使用場景 某大型 部署是分布式的,訂單系統有三颱伺服器響應使用者請求,生成訂單後統一存放到order info表 order info表要求訂單id order id 必須是唯一的,那麼三颱伺服器怎麼協同工作來確認order id的唯一性呢?這時候就要用到分布式鎖了。分布式鎖的要求 在了解了使用場景...

基於資料庫的分布式鎖實現

一 基於資料庫表 要實現分布式鎖,最簡單的方式可能就是直接建立一張鎖表,然後通過操作該表中的資料來實現了。當我們要鎖住某個方法或資源的時候,我們就在該表中增加一條記錄,想要釋放鎖的時候就刪除這條記錄。建立這樣一張資料庫表 create table methodlock id int 11 not n...

基於資料庫的分布式鎖實現

一 基於資料庫表 要實現分布式鎖,最簡單的方式可能就是直接建立一張鎖表,然後通過操作該表中的資料來實現了。當要鎖住某個方法或資源的時候,就在該表中增加一條記錄,想要釋放鎖的時候就刪除這條記錄。建立這樣一張資料庫表 create table methodlock id int 11 not null ...